By ranging from a weaker cellular stage and strengthening it over the runtime, gradient elution decreases the retention of your later-eluting components so that they elute a lot quicker, giving narrower (and taller) peaks for most components, although also making it possible for for your enough separation of earlier-eluting elements. This also increases the height shape for tailed peaks, given that the increasing focus with the organic and natural eluent pushes the tailing Section of a peak forward.

A more robust mobile period would make improvements to problems with runtime and broadening of afterwards peaks but leads to diminished peak separation, specifically for swiftly eluting analytes which may have inadequate time to totally solve. This situation is tackled in the changing cell period composition of gradient elution.

There are distinctive dissimilarities concerning displacement and elution chromatography. In elution method, substances usually emerge from a column in narrow, Gaussian peaks. Vast separation of peaks, if possible to baseline, is preferred as a way to achieve highest purification. The pace at which any part of a mix travels down the column in elution mode is dependent upon lots of components. But for two substances to vacation at various speeds, and therefore be solved, there have to read more be sizeable variances in some conversation between the biomolecules and the chromatography matrix. Running parameters are modified to maximize the influence of the difference.

In the case of electrospray ionization, the ion resource moves ions that exist in liquid Option to the gas phase. The ion resource converts and fragments the neutral sample molecules into gasoline-phase ions which have been despatched for the mass analyzer. Although the mass analyzer applies the electrical and magnetic fields to type the ions by their masses, the detector measures and amplifies the ion latest to compute the abundances of every mass-resolved ion. So that you can make a mass spectrum that a human eye can certainly figure out, the data system records, procedures, stores, and displays data in a pc.[five]

In ion-exchange chromatography (IC), retention is based to the attraction between solute ions and charged websites bound to the stationary section. Solute ions of exactly the same charge because the charged sites around the column are excluded from binding, whilst solute ions of the opposite demand of the billed web-sites on the column are retained about the column.

Organic extractions can be achieved on soils and the different substances divided. The result is a profile on the soil. The substances inside the mixture are not discovered, though the profile is actually a handy way of pinpointing regardless of whether a soil uncovered at a crime scene could have originate from a particular location.
